ysqladminysqladmin来更改MysqL用户的密码。首先,您需要通过以下命令停止MysqL服务器:
ctlysql
ysqladmin -u root password NEW_PASSWORD
请注意,这将更改MysqL root用户的密码。如果您想更改其他用户的密码,请将“root”替换为该用户的用户名。
ysqld_safe
ysqladminysqldysqld_safe是MysqL的另一个命令行实用程序,可以帮助您启动MysqL服务器并跳过密码验证。请按照以下步骤操作:
1. 停止MysqL服务器:
ctlysql
ysqld_safe:
ysqldt-tables &
ysql -u root
ysql.user SET Password=PASSWORD('NEW_PASSWORD') WHERE User='root';
5. 刷新MysqL权限:
FLUSH PRIVILEGES;
7. 重新启动MysqL服务器:
ctlysql
3. 使用忘记密码脚本
ysqladminysqld脚本,可以帮助您重置MysqL用户的密码。请按照以下步骤操作:
1. 下载忘记密码脚本:
tentsonysqlasterysql-forgot-password.py
2. 运行忘记密码脚本:
ysql-forgot-password.py
3. 输入MysqL的root密码(如果已设置):
ter the MysqL root password:
4. 选择要更改密码的用户:
teramett to reset:
5. 输入新密码:
terewt:
6. 重新启动MysqL服务器:
ctlysql
ysqladminysqld_safe或忘记密码脚本可以帮助您更改MysqL用户的密码。如果您仍然无法解决问题,请考虑重新安装MysqL服务器。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。